Web22 mei 2011 · A thunderstorm is classified as severe if its winds reach or exceed 58 mph, it produces a tornado, or it drops surface hail at least 0.75 in. in diameter. Thunderstorms may occur singly, in clusters, or in lines. Thus, it is possible for several thunderstorms to affect one location in the course of a few hours. The single-cell. The multi-cell. The squall line. The supercell. In their infancy, most thunderstorms start off as towering cumulus clouds. Moist parcels of air rise, expand, and cool, causing these clouds to grow. This creates what we call an updraft.
